Head of the Endowment Office for Christian- Yazidi- and Mandaean Religions Dr. Rami Joseph Agajan Visits Armenian Catholic Diocese Emphasizes State Support for Religious Communities and Peaceful Coexistence.

On Thursday morning, Dr. Rami Joseph Agajan, head of the Endowment Office for Christian, Yazidi, and Mandaean religions, conducted an official visit to the Armenian Catholic Diocese in Baghdad, where he met with Bishop Mar Nerses Joseph, head of the community in Iraq.

During the meeting, discussions focused on enhancing cooperation between the Endowment Office and the Armenian Catholic community, reviewing its current status, and addressing challenges, particularly in the current circumstances, while exploring ways to support religious and social initiatives.

Dr. Agajan emphasized the importance of religious communities in reinforcing values of peace and coexistence, praising Bishop Mar Nerses Joseph’s efforts in strengthening national harmony and promoting a culture of dialogue and tolerance.

For his part, Bishop Mar Nerses Joseph expressed his appreciation for Dr. Agajan’s visit, commending the state’s active role, through the Endowment Office, in supporting the institutions of the Armenian Catholic community and empowering them to fulfill their spiritual and social mission, reflecting Iraq’s commitment to religious diversity.

This meeting comes as part of the Endowment Office’s ongoing efforts to strengthen communication bridges with various religious communities, contributing to social cohesion and preserving Iraq’s rich national fabric.
